The FIFA World Cup 26™ will mark the first time that the tournament features 48 teams and will be hosted by three countries: Canada, Mexico, and the United States. This new format redefines excellence, generating unique opportunities for greater participation and engagement from fans and players in North America and all over the world. Reporting organisationally to the Senior Manager, Pitch Infrastructure, the Manager, Pitch will be a key member of the FIFA26 Pitch Management team, and work in close collaboration with the Infrastructure team responsible for the integration and monitoring of the overall pitch management strategy into the host cities pitch programmes to achieve consistency and uniformity across all Cluster Stadiums & Training Sites.
